Pte. Charles William Timmins

Royal Marines 2nd Royal Marine Btn.

from:Derby

I know nothing of the service life of my Grandad, Bill Timmin I have only recently found out that he was a Royal Marine. I do know that later in the war he was shot and wounded but eventually made a full recovery.

He subsequently became a Steward at various clubs in the Derby area, met his wife Ethel, and had two daughters Patricia (my mother) and Margaret. In the late 1940's he owned and ran the New Inn pub at Pen St., Boston, Lincs before selling and retiring in the early 1960s. Growing up, we lived next door to him and I spent hours in his company. What fantastic great memories. We would go fishing, walking and generally enjoy a very happy time together.
